The Weeknd Makes Sizable Donation To Help With Devastating Wildfires

The Weeknd is not only known for being super talented but also for being very dedicated to humanitarian causes.
Over the past week, he cancelled an album release concert so he could focus on the community relief efforts. He put the following on his social media -
“Out of respect and concern for the people of Los Angeles County, i am canceling the Rose Bowl concert originally scheduled for January 25th,”
“This city has always been a profound source of inspiration for me, and my thoughts are with everyone impacted during this difficult time. In light of this, i have also decided to push the release of my album to January 31st. My focus remains on supporting the recovery of these communities and aiding its incredible people as they rebuild.”
He also just recently made a $1 Million donation to help the LAFD Foundation that will go towards helping with the devastation in both the Palisades and Eaton, GoFundMe's Wildlife Relief Fund, and the LA Regional Food Bank. The money will help not only the firefighters but also, displaced residents and affected families.
